外汇交易策略的优化对于交易的盈利至关重要,而MQL4编程神器可以帮助交易者快速调试和优化自己的交易策略。本文将介绍MQL4编程神器的基本概念和使用方法,并提供优化外汇交易策略的实用技巧。通过学习本文内容,交易者可以更好地掌握MQL4编程神器,提升自己的交易技术水平。
一、MQL4编程神器概述
MQL4是MetaTrader 4 (MT4)交易平台的专用语言,可用于编写自动化交易脚本(通常称为“Expert Advisors”或简称“EAs”),以及用于分析市场数据、生成技术指标和执行其他自定义任务的脚本。为了使用MQL4编程神器,您需要具备基本的编程知识(例如C语言),以及掌握MT4交易平台的基本操作。
二、使用MQL4编程神器优化交易策略
1. 多空头寻找中心点
在外汇交易过程中,寻找多空头之间的差异通常是一项很重要的工作。可以使用MQL4编程神器来开发一个简单的指标来确定多头和空头之间的中心点。编写指标的基本思路是,找到最高价和最低价的平均值,作为多头和空头之间的中心点。然后,通过使用该中心点来衡量当前价格相对于其历史区间的位置。
2. 支撑和阻力水平
支撑和阻力水平是一种广泛使用的技术分析工具,在外汇交易中尤其重要。通俗地说,支撑和阻力水平用于确定交易市场在特定价格区间内遇到障碍的位置。可以使用MQL4编程神器来编写指标,以确定这些水平。
编写指标时,我们可以利用历史数据来查找价格发生重大变化的位置,并将其标记为“技术关键水平”。然后,通过检查当前价格是否接近这些水平,我们可以预测下一步市场走势。
3. 移动平均线交叉
移动平均线交叉是一种常见的技术分析方法,在外汇交易中也被广泛使用。它基于两条移动平均线之间的相互穿越,以确定市场趋势的变化。可以使用MQL4编程神器来编写交叉指标并进行优化。
编写指标时,我们需要确定适当的移动平均线时间间隔,并通过计算两条移动平均线的交叉点来确定市场走势。可以使用回测工具进行测试,以判断特定移动平均线设置的优劣,并对自己的交易策略进行相应的调整。
三、总结
MQL4编程神器是一个非常有用的工具,在外汇交易策略优化中发挥着关键作用。通过了解本文介绍的实用技巧,您可以更好地掌握MQL4编程神器,提高自己的交易技术水平,并找到适合自己的外汇交易策略。无论您是一个新手还是一个有经验的交易者,MQL4编程神器都可以加速您的学习和增强您的交易策略优化。